All rights reserved. http://www.us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://www.usgwarchives.net/ga/gafiles.htm ************************************************ File contributed for use in USGenWeb Archives by: Carla Miles cmhistory@mchsi.com February 1, 2004, 12:39 am The Butler Herald, November 5, 1912 The Butler Herald Tuesday, November 5, 1912 Page One Leslie Citizens Have Pistol Duel; One Killed Americus, Nov. 3 – In a pistol duel occurring late last night at Leslie, twelve miles from Americus, Robert Laramore was instantly killed by Luther Allison, a real estate dealer and well known citizen of the town. The tragedy occurred in the store of the Leslie Hardware Company, and was witnessed by several citizens. From meager reports received here today of the homicide, it appears that Mr. Laramore, a Lee County farmer, residing near Leslie, was more or less under the influence of drink, and had been the greater part of the day. He and Allison had a slight difficulty earlier in the day, and this, quite likely, was renewed when the men met last night in the store of the Leslie Hardware Company.
